Quick Start

  1. Go to MANAGE → Booking Page.
  2. Select Front page.
  3. Scroll to the Booking Cart section.
  4. Enable or disable the toggle for Multi-Booking.
  5. Click Save to apply changes instantly.
Note: Multi-booking is enabled by default.

How Multi-Booking Works

  • Clients can add multiple services, event tickets, or resource-based bookings into one cart.
  • All selected items appear in a unified checkout summary before payment.
  • Each item keeps its own:
    • Resource (e.g., Barber Joe, Room A)
    • Duration
    • Price
    • Availability rules
  • After checkout, Oskar automatically creates separate bookings in your Calendar — one per item.
This makes it perfect for clients booking combinations like:
  • “Haircut + Beard Trim”
  • “Yoga Class + Mat Rental”
  • “Room Booking + Event Ticket”

Limit Bookings per Client

You can restrict how many appointments a client can book with a specific resource in one order.
  1. Go to MANAGE → Resources → [Resource Name].
  2. Open Booking Capacity.
  3. Set a value under Customer Booking Limit.
Example:
Limit “Sauna Room” to 1 per customer to avoid multiple overlapping bookings.

Notes & Best Practices

  • When multi-booking is disabled, clients can only book one item per checkout.
  • The cart supports both free and paid bookings.
  • Payments follow each item’s individual payment configuration (Stripe or offline).
  • Multi-booking works seamlessly with:
    • Add-ons & extras
    • Sub-resources
    • Events with multiple ticket types
    • Overnight bookings
